Lucy Thornton Slaughter 1739–1832 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 2 JUL 1739

Birth Location: Caroline County, Virginia

Death Date: 19 FEB 1832

Death Location: Amherst, Amherst, Virginia, United States

Father: Thomas Slaughter

Mother: Sarah Thornton

Spouse(s): Jesse Slaughter, Benjamin Robinson

Children(s): Jesse Slaughter, Mary Slaughter, Benjamin Robinson

Lucy Thornton Slaughter was born in 1739 in Caroline County, Virginia, the child of Thomas Slaughter And Sarah Thornton. Lucy Thornton Slaughter married Benjamin Robinson, Jesse Slaughter, and had children including Benjamin Robinson, Jesse Slaughter, Mary Slaughter. Lucy Thornton Slaughter passed away in 1832 in Amherst, Amherst, Virginia, United States.
